Output d81a66e5cd3fe7d1e300d94b0adf2339c418cfc589a057377661d5a5528c5509:24
- value
- 253806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a008ad338964d1f36fce8860a5a0c7d6932f72c4 OP_EQUAL
- address
- 3GHCS6UCcHZzruZKJDgm2yEzPwyAZERkWr
- transaction
- d81a66e5cd3fe7d1e300d94b0adf2339c418cfc589a057377661d5a5528c5509
- confirmations
- 266909
- spent
- true